摘要
随机扩增多态性DNA(RAPD)是目前常用的DNA指纹图谱技术。采用改进的“ROSE法”提取DNA ,并建立了重复性较好的RAPD标准分析条件。在此标准条件下 ,检测了烟草 10个品种材料基因组的多态性。经 10个引物扩增 ,在得到的 53条扩增带中 ,有 10个片段为 10个材料所共有 ,多态性达81.1%。其中引物P7的扩增图谱 ,各品种间可以互相区别 ,差异明显 ,可用作烟草
Random amplified polymorphic DNA (RAPD) is a popular technique of fingerprinting. Good quality DNAs were extracted from 10 varieties accessions of tobacco by using improved “ROSE” method. Reproducible amplification products were obtained with rigorously optimized reaction conditions. Fifty\|three amplification fragments were generated by RAPD with 10 primers, among which 10 fragments were shared by all 10 accessions. The degree of polymorphism was 81.1%. RAPD patterns of 10 accessions generated by P 7 could be used as DNA fingerprint for identification of 10 tobacco varieties.
